Double Celebrations for Leeds Bradford

Double Celebrations for Leeds Bradford
6 January 2004

It was double celebrations at Leeds Bradford International Airport as they looked forward to a ‘New Year’ after achieving 2 million passengers in 2003.

This milestone marks the end of a ‘record breaking’ year for one of the fastest growing regional airports in the UK. The busy Christmas period was the ‘icing on the cake’ for the passenger throughput in December and LBA Managing Director, Ed Anderson is delighted, “This represents growth of 32% over the previous year and is due in no small part to our new low cost airline jet2.com, which commenced operations last February.”

With more services and choice for customers, there has been continuous development over the last 12 months to enhance the facilities for passengers. April will see the completion of a new check in area that will provide a further 16 check in desks for the airport, bringing it to a total of 42.

Mr Anderson also comments, “It was very pleasing to hear the Government White Paper envisages a greater role for regional airports over the coming years, including the continuing growth and development of Leeds Bradford Airport.”
